9:00 AM - 9:45 AM    Sensory Friendly Open Gym - Sensory Friendly Open Gym Saturdays
Sensory Friendly Open Gym is a dedicated time for children and their families who may  enjoy a quieter and less crowded open gym time. Our goal for this open gym time is create an environment that is not over stimulating compared to our other open Gym times. During Sensory Friendly Open Gym, we will decrease the lighting, and provide sensory toys and equipment. The gym will be divided into two separate spaces, one half will be for sports related free play. On the other half there will be matted areas, small sensory toys, large foam shapes and blue building blocks.Please be mindful of the dates/schedule as there are some days off during the session and in between sessions.

10:00 AM - 11:00 AM    Wrestling Program - Girls Wrestling Clinic
This program will cover the basics of wrestling, and each practice will be formatted the same. We will start with a dynamic warm-up to ensure the athletes are prepared. We will then do technique work, learning the basics, takedowns, defense, and groundwork. We will then pick up the intensity briefly to apply what we have learned in that session to a match setting (with skill, ability, and safety as our priority). To finish, we will do conditioning through activities and games. I want to ensure each wrestler has some growth, no matter how small. 6:00 PM - 6:45 PM    Coordination Station - Coordination Station
Medford Recreation coordination station, indoors at the recreation center. all equipment provided.  Coach Sue will teach various skills to develop stronger coordination. This will include directionality, spatial awareness, crossing the midline, and balance. Basic skills -hopping, skipping, running, galloping and jumping will be practiced each session in a lively, non competitive atmosphere. To strengthen balance low balance beams, rolling, poses, and balance pads. To strengthen directionality and focus scooter boards and parachutes will be used. Instruction will focus on development and enjoyment of the various strengthening activities. Each class will end with a new challenging obstacle course. Please wear sneakers.

9:00 AM - 5:00 PM    Multi-Sport Program w/ Nora - Multi-Sport Program
A "multi-sport program" is a structured athletic program that exposes participants to a variety of different sports, rather than focusing on just one, allowing them to learn basic skills and experience various activities within a single program. This program is designed to keep kids engaged, excited, and active throughout the day.  Here’s how it will work: We’ll focus on a variety of sports (soccer, basketball, volleyball, etc), dedicating a couple of hours to each one before rotating to the next. This structure will help keep things fresh and fun, allowing kids to experience different skills and challenges without feeling bored or fatigued. The rotation will also ensure that children have the opportunity to explore multiple sports, develop a well-rounded skill set. Additionally, we’ll incorporate breaks and activities between rotations to maintain energy levels and enthusiasm. The goal is to make the experience dynamic and enjoyable while focusing on teamwork, discipline, and a love for movement.
